What is Alipay?

Alipay (支付宝) is Alibaba’s mobile payment platform, accepted at over 80 million merchants across China. Along with WeChat Pay, it’s one of the two dominant payment methods in the country.

Setting Up Alipay (5 Steps)

Step 1: Download the App

StoreSearch
iOSApp Store → “Alipay”
AndroidGoogle Play → “Alipay”

Step 2: Create Your Account

  1. Open app → Tap Sign Up
  2. Enter your phone number (with country code)
  3. Enter SMS verification code
  4. Set your password

Step 3: Identity Verification

Me → Settings → Account & Security → Identity Verification

  1. Select Foreigner
  2. Upload your passport photo page
  3. Complete facial recognition (selfie)
  4. Processing: Usually 1-3 minutes (up to 1-3 days)

💡 Pro tip: Complete verification 1-3 days before your trip—it can take time!

Step 4: Add Your Card

Me → Bank Cards → Add

FieldInput
Card Number16 digits
Expiry DateMM/YY
CVV3 digits on back
OTPBank verification code

Step 5: Set Payment PIN

Create a 6-digit PIN for transactions.

Total setup time: 5-10 minutes

Transaction Limits & Fees

Limits (Increased March 2024!)

TypeAmount
Per Transaction$5,000 (~¥36,000)
Monthly¥50,000 (~$7,000)
Annual$50,000 (~¥360,000)

Previous limits were $1,000 per transaction, $10,000 annual. 5x increase!

Fees

Transaction AmountFee
Under ¥200Free
Over ¥2003%

UnionPay Fee Advantage

CardFee
Visa/Mastercard2-3% (card fee) + 3% (over ¥200)
UnionPay~0.8% + no 3% fee

How to Pay with Alipay

Method 1: Scan Merchant QR

Used at small shops, street vendors, restaurants.

  1. Open Alipay
  2. Tap Scan on home screen
  3. Scan the merchant’s QR code
  4. Confirm amount
  5. Enter 6-digit PIN (or use biometrics)
  6. Show completion screen to vendor

Method 2: Show Your Barcode

Used at supermarkets, convenience stores, chain stores.

  1. Open Alipay
  2. Tap Pay on home screen
  3. Display your barcode/QR
  4. Show to cashier
  5. Cashier scans → payment complete

Method 3: Alipay Tap (NFC) 🆕

Alipay’s standout feature! Launched mid-2024, 100M+ users.

  1. Open Alipay app (screen unlocked)
  2. Tap phone on merchant’s NFC tag
  3. Payment screen opens automatically
  4. Confirm and done

Troubleshooting

Problem 1: Passport Verification Failed

Fix:

  • Take clear, well-lit photo
  • No glare, include entire page
  • Face should match passport photo

Problem 2: SMS Code Not Arriving

Fix:

  • Check carrier international SMS settings
  • Disable SMS filters temporarily
  • Verify country code
  • Contact hotline 95188

Problem 3: Card Registration Rejected

CauseSolution
Overseas transactions blockedContact card issuer to enable China online payments
Card not supportedOnly Visa, MC, JCB, Discover, Diners work
Name mismatchCard name = passport name (exactly!)
Region settingMe → Settings → Region → International

Problem 4: Card Works in WeChat but Not Alipay

Some cards have platform-specific compatibility. Try a different card.

Tax Refund

Get instant tax refunds through Alipay!

Supported CitiesMethod
Beijing, Shanghai, Shenzhen, GuangzhouTap-to-Refund directly to Alipay wallet
  1. Get tax refund form at store
  2. Get customs stamp at airport
  3. Alipay → Tax Refund → Tap for instant refund

Pre-Trip Checklist

Before departure:

  • Download Alipay app
  • Create account
  • Complete identity verification (passport + selfie)
  • Enable international transactions on your card
  • Add card to Alipay

After arriving in China:

  • Test with small purchase
  • Try NFC Tap payment
  • Have backup payment ready
